Also this month I celebrate 6 years from my last diagnosis. A couple weeks before my birthday I went in because of a strange tumorlike looking thing I woke up with one day and about a week after I received a phone call telling me my worst nightmare had came back after 12 years. I had surgery very soon after that and was in recovery from July to October. This was the year we got involved with the Relay For Life. My team came in first place raising almost $10,000 in one week.
